Young winemaker César Márquez's entry level Mencia is a real discovery. High altitude, old vines (mainly 100 years+) from vineyards around the region of Valtuille de Abajo. The whole bunch winemaking gives the wine a delicious red berry perfume with hints of violet and liquorice spice. The tannins are chalky and very integrated into the wine's juicy core.
